Output f9c3eae717cf94818c2c37a867fa4c84d7ba2cb038f9b6a6585d504af264e054:0

value
10407696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df378ae953296b35f2fdd94581f0521081a0990b OP_EQUAL
address
3N3H9VS3yRkBYMDKpRtAu7nsafbyRxJPCV
transaction
f9c3eae717cf94818c2c37a867fa4c84d7ba2cb038f9b6a6585d504af264e054
confirmations
484352
spent
true